The size of Hallam is approximately 8.3 square kilometres. It has 30 parks covering nearly 6.4% of total area. The population of Hallam in 2016 was 10852 people. By 2021 the population was 11355 showing a population growth of 4.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Hallam is 20-29 years. Households in Hallam are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Hallam work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 70.50% of the homes in Hallam were owner-occupied compared with 71.60% in 2016.
